The Astral Express hovered silently before an unfamiliar star sector. Beyond the windows lay a planet shrouded in chaos, isolated from the world, shaped like an ∞ symbol.

It was utterly different from any world the Express had explored before.

The mokeeper—Black Swan—stood gracefully in the center of the observation car, a hint of pride born from uncovering secrets about her, as she presented the unique sight outside to the Express crew.

"Behold, this is that almost entirely isolated lost world, with no records in the Data Bank, a place even the great Akivili (Aeon of Trailblaze) never set foot upon—’The Eternal Land, Amphoreus.’"

Her fingertip traced the star chart, leaving faint trails of light. "According to the Garden of Recollection’s observations, only three Paths converge stably in this star sector, an exceedingly rare phenonon even in the vast universe."

"So, according to you," Hiko’s gaze shifted from the overly tranquil planet outside back to Black Swan, her pupils holding a hint of scrutiny, "ordinary Pathstriders would find it difficult to leave such clear, intense Path echoes in such a closed world. Therefore..."

She paused, her tone growing more serious. "Within this isolated star system, at least three existences with strength comparable to Emanators have been born."

"Miss Black Swan, I must confirm with you once more, in my capacity as the Express’s Navigator—can you truly ensure this journey deep into the unknown, this trailblazing expedition, is safe for the Express, and for every person aboard?"

"As the Express’s head of family, safeguarding every passenger’s safety must be my foremost consideration."

"Absolute safety on the path of Trailblazing is itself a luxury," Black Swan responded frankly, yet her tone remained confident. "I believe the Garden dispatching only for this liaison is itself a signal—even if problems exist, their severity should remain within controllable bounds." She offered Hiko this assurance.

"Hmm? ...By the way, where’s March?" Welt Yang’s voice interjected. He looked around, seeming to notice sothing.

"March..." Stelle also reacted. The car seed a bit too quiet, missing the usual lively voice of the pink-haired girl.

"She should be in her room," Dan Heng provided a clue tily. "I rember before the Express departed, she said she wanted to organize photos from the previous journey, and then never ca out."

"Strange... Let’s go check her room together." The vague unease in Hiko’s heart grew clearer. She took the lead.

Inside March 7th’s room.

"Stop... stop arguing..." The pink-haired girl clutched her forehead painfully, trying to shake out the chaotic murmurs filling her mind.

*Find him... that thief... robber... find the thief who stole the power of the ’Flawless Lord’... retrieve that power... stop... this is... the duty of all mokeepers...*

An extrely faint streak of red light flashed at the edge of her vision.

Then, the noise in her mind receded slightly. External sounds beca clear again.

"March? March?" Familiar, concerned calls from her companions.

"Wha, what’s wrong?" March 7th snapped back to awareness, her face pale. The worried faces of the Express crew filled her view.

"March, your face was terrifyingly pale just now." Hiko stepped forward, gently supporting her shoulders. "Are you feeling unwell?"

"Maybe... a little..." March 7th’s voice carried a rare weakness and confusion, utterly devoid of her usual vitality.

"It seems to be a ntal issue. Let us examine you..." Almost simultaneously, Sunday and Black Swan offered their assistance.

...

A short while later.

Welt stood outside March 7th’s door, speaking softly to Stelle and Dan Heng who were waiting outside. "Mr. Sunday and Miss Black Swan have both done preliminary examinations. March’s condition... they cannot fully determine the cause."

"But they both gave the sa suggestion: until the cause is identified, temporarily keep March away from Amphoreus. That world might possess so power that resonates with or conflicts with her current state."

"So, this trailblazing journey might have to be entrusted to you and Dan Heng..." Before Welt could finish, his words were interrupted by a burst of manically joyous laughter.

"Ahahahaha! Aha suggests—this man who looks very reliable and steady should go down and take a look too!"

An exaggerated red mask, like a ghost, pressed against the Express’s outer window. Ignoring physical barriers, it transmitted its voice into everyone’s ears from the vacuum outside.

Welt’s expression instantly turned extrely grave. Almost instinctively, he stepped forward, shielding Stelle and Dan Heng behind him, his cane thudding heavily on the floor.

"The Elation Aeon, Aha..." he said grimly, his tone full of vigilance.

However, Aha clearly had no interest in any logical conversation. "Aha knows nothing—Aha only knows how to laugh hahaha!"

Accompanied by even more cheerful laughter, the red mask vanished as abruptly as it appeared, leaving only a disquieting aftertaste lingering in the car.

Welt exchanged a glance with Hiko who had hurried over upon hearing the commotion. Both their faces were etched with unspeakable gravity.

Aha’s intervention never ant anything but trouble and variables. Never anything good.
